Research shows that indoor plants help rid the air of common toxins and indoor pollutants such as formaldehyde and benzene. snake plants, spider plants, rubber plants, peace lilies, ferns and english ivy are some of the best indoor plants for boosting oxygen levels and purifying the air. sleeping with plants in your bedroom: the findings suggest that “indoor plants can reduce physiological and psychological stress,” the study authors. studies have also proven that indoor plants improve concentration and productivity (by up to 15 percent!), reduce.
